Fernando Rover Jr. is a San Antonio based author and artist whose work comprises of elements of prose, poetry, photography, film, and performance art. He holds a dual Bachelor’s degree in English and history from Texas Lutheran University and a Master of Arts in Interdisciplinary Studies from Prescott College. Through his imprint Frame Reference Media, his work focuses on queer Black male experiences, mental health, social consciousness, and impact-based art.
His work has appeared in numerous publications and anthologies, including Odyssey Online, Caged Bird, Black Press USA, and the San Antonio Observer. He is the author of three poetry collections: ‘Labyrinth’ (2019) ‘Sanctuary’: A ‘Labyrinth’ Redux (2020), and, ‘Maverick’ (2022). All of Rover Jr's books are available for purchase on Amazon.
